Govt sets Zakat Nisab

KARACHI: The federal government has fixed the “Nisab for Zakat” for the year 1446-47 A.H. at Rs 503,529 for deductions from savings bank accounts, profit and loss sharing accounts, and similar deposits.

This year’s Nisab is about 180 percent higher than that of 1445–46 A.H., when it was set at Rs 179,689. The sharp increase reflects the rise in gold prices in the international market, which is used as the benchmark for calculating the Nisab.

According to State Bank of Pakistan, the Administrator General Zakat has notified the “Nisab of Zakat” for the Zakat Year 1446-1447 A.H. at Rs 503,529 (Rupees Five Hundred Three Thousand Five Hundred Twenty-Nine only). A notification issued by the Ministry of Poverty Alleviation And Social Safety said that in terms of the provisions of the Zakat and Ushr Ordinance, 1980 no deduction of Zakat at source shall be effected where the amount standing to the credit of an account, in respect of the assets mentioned in Column 2 of Serial No 1 of the First Schedule of the said Ordinance is less than Rs 503,529 as on the first day of Ramazan-ul-Mubarak, 1447 A.H.

The first day of Ramazan-ul-Mubarak, 1447 A.H. has been notified as the “Deduction Date” which is likely to fall on 19th or 20th February, 2026 (subject to appearance of the moon) for deduction of Zakat from Saving Bank Accounts, Profit andLoss Sharing Accounts and other similar accounts having a credit balance of Rs 503,529 or above.

All Zakat Collecting and Controlling Agencies (ZCCAs) have been directed to ensure strict compliance with the instructions and deduct Zakat accordingly. The deducted amount shall be deposited immediately in the Central Zakat Account No CZ-08 maintained with the State Bank of Pakistan, the notification said.
